What Does a Home Equity Loan Specialist in Davenport Cost?
Typical costs for a home equity loan specialist in Florida include an origination fee of 0.5 to 1.5 percent of the loan amount, appraisal fees from 300 to 500 dollars, and closing costs ranging from 2 to 5 percent of the loan. Some lenders charge a flat fee of 500 to 1,000 dollars for processing. These costs vary by lender and loan size. This is general information and not mortgage or financial advice.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is a home equity loan and how does it work in Florida?
A home equity loan lets you borrow against the value of your home minus what you owe. In Florida, lenders typically require at least 15 to 20 percent equity. You receive a lump sum and repay it with fixed monthly payments over a set term.
What documents do I need to apply for a home equity loan in Davenport?
You will need proof of income such as pay stubs or tax returns, a recent property appraisal, and documentation of your current mortgage. Florida lenders also require a credit check and may ask for a copy of your homeowners insurance policy.
Are there any Florida-specific rules for home equity loans?
Yes, Florida law requires a three-day right of rescission for most home equity loans, meaning you can cancel the loan within three business days after signing. Also, Florida has a homestead exemption that may affect how much equity is protected from creditors.
